CSModuleStatus
in package
Defines a module status
Tags
Table of Contents
- createStatus() : CSModuleStatus
- Creates an instance of a module status
- getEntries() : array<string|int, CSModuleStatusEntry>
- Returns all status entries
- getErrors() : array<string|int, CSModuleStatusEntry>
- Returns all status entries with the type error
- getModule() : CSModule
- Returns the module instance
- getType() : ModuleStatusType
- Returns the current status type
- getWarnings() : array<string|int, CSModuleStatusEntry>
- Returns all status entries with the type warnings
Methods
createStatus()
Creates an instance of a module status
public
static createStatus(CSModule $oModule[, array<string|int, CSModuleStatusEntry> $aEntries = array() ]) : CSModuleStatus
Parameters
- $oModule : CSModule
-
The module instance
- $aEntries : array<string|int, CSModuleStatusEntry> = array()
-
List of status entries
Tags
Return values
CSModuleStatus —The module status instance
getEntries()
Returns all status entries
public
getEntries() : array<string|int, CSModuleStatusEntry>
Tags
Return values
array<string|int, CSModuleStatusEntry> —List of status entries
getErrors()
Returns all status entries with the type error
public
getErrors() : array<string|int, CSModuleStatusEntry>
Tags
Return values
array<string|int, CSModuleStatusEntry> —List of status entries
getModule()
Returns the module instance
public
getModule() : CSModule
Tags
Return values
CSModule —The module instance
getType()
Returns the current status type
public
getType() : ModuleStatusType
Tags
Return values
ModuleStatusType —The status type of the current module status instance
getWarnings()
Returns all status entries with the type warnings
public
getWarnings() : array<string|int, CSModuleStatusEntry>
Tags
Return values
array<string|int, CSModuleStatusEntry> —List of status entries
